          Abstract

          Liver stiffness measurement (LSM), using elastography, can independently predict outcomes of patients with chronic liver diseases (CLDs). However, there is much variation in reporting and consistency of findings. We performed a systematic review and meta-analysis to evaluate the association between LSM and outcomes of patients with CLDs.
